Reading: Suzan Shown Harjo

Monday, 4/26
1:00 - 2:00
Humanities 108

Suzan Shown Harjo is a poet, writer, lecturer, curator and policy advocate, who has helped Native communities recover more than 1,000,000 acres of land and numerous sacred places. Harjo (Cheyenne and Holdugee Muscogee) is President of the Native rights organization The Morning Star Institute, a Founding Trustee of the National Museum of the American Indian, a recipient of the Dobkin Native
American Artist Fellowship from the School of American Research, and the first Vine Deloria, Jr. Distinguished Indigenous Scholar at the University of Arizona. Her poems have appeared in numerous journals and several anthologies, including Reinventing the Enemy's Language, The Remembered Earth, and Third World Women.
